The Story of Niia
Niia first appeared in U.S. Social Security Administration records as a baby girl name in 2008, with 6 babies given the name that year. Its peak popularity came in 2008, when 6 Niias were born — ranking #15,404 that year. As of 2026, Niia ranks #15,532 for baby girls with 5 births, with steady use. In total, more than 11 Niias have been born in the U.S. since records began in 1880, spanning the 2000s through the 2020s.
